Mike - Could be a weak governor spring. Unfortunately, those are no longer available from Deere, unless the dealer has some in stock. You might try attaching the spring to a different hole in the governor to see if that helps. Otherwise, contact a Cummins/Onan dealer to see if they carry the sping. - Dave
